What Is Visual AI Visibility and Why It Matters
Visual AI visibility, or AI image monitoring, goes beyond clicks and views. It taps into object detection, scene understanding and content recommendation engines that power many image and video platforms. In short, it tracks when and where your logos, packaging or product shots appear in AI-driven feeds.
You might think it’s all about brand vanity, but it’s more than that. Insights from AI image monitoring help you:
– Spot trending visuals that resonate with your audience
– Identify misrepresentations or negative contexts
– Compare your imagery against competitors in real time

The Mechanics Behind AI-Powered Image and Video Recommendations
At the core of AI image monitoring lie three key layers:
1. Object Detection: AI tags every item in your photo—from logos to landmarks
2. Metadata Analysis: Contextual data like scene type, colours and detected moods
3. Recommendation Logic: Algorithms that rank visuals based on user behaviour, location and relevance
Imagine your product photo in a busy feed. The AI spots the item, reads any text on it, assesses if it fits a user’s profile and then decides if it’s worth recommending. Now multiply that by thousands of platforms. Without a monitoring tool, it’s impossible to know where you stand.
